96-year-old DJ bids farewell to long-running radio show in Hong Kong


By AGENCY
In this photo provided by Radio Television Hong Kong (RTHK), Ray Cordeiro, also known as Uncle Ray, gestures after he finished his last show 'All The Way With Ray' at the studio in RTHK. Photos: AP

After more than seven decades in radio, a 96-year-old Hong Kong DJ bid farewell to his listeners Saturday (May 15) with Time To Say Goodbye, sung by Sarah Brightman and Andrea Bocelli.

"Well that’s it. Thank you very much for tuning in, goodbye, thank you for coming,” Ray Cordeiro said in both English and Cantonese before signing off ahead of the 1am news.
